Ammochostos Municipality, Famagusta Magusa, Cyprus

Overview

Ammochostos Municipality, encompassing the lively southeastern coast of Cyprus, is renowned for its idyllic beaches, relaxed Mediterranean lifestyle, and mix of tradition and modernity. The area is a hub for both local culture and tourism, offering everything from lively resorts to quiet villages.

Best Time to Visit

April-June and September-October for warm weather and fewer crowds

Local Tips

Renting a car is recommended for exploring nearby villages and remote beaches. Many shops observe afternoon siesta hours, so plan shopping accordingly.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 5-10% in restaurants is appreciated. Dress modestly when visiting churches or traditional villages, and greet with a friendly 'Yia sou!'

Safety Warnings

Generally very safe, but take standard precautions at busy beaches and tourist hotspots to avoid petty theft. Avoid crossing into restricted buffer zones near the north.

Hidden Gems

Deryneia Folklore Museum, scenic Agios Nikolaos chapel by the sea in Protaras, and the lesser-known Fireman's Park in Paralimni.
